Due to Keene's mountainous terrain and harsh winter conditions, common issues include premature brake wear, suspension component stress, and corrosion from road salt. Many local Kia owners also report issues with ignition coils and engine recalls specific to certain models like the Sorento and Sportage, which should be addressed promptly.

While labor rates in Keene may be competitive, the remote location can sometimes increase the cost and time for obtaining specific Kia parts, potentially raising repair bills. It's wise to get a detailed estimate that includes parts sourcing timelines, especially before winter when demand for repairs increases.

The mountainous and seasonal climate demands more frequent attention to tires, brakes, and undercarriage washes to combat salt corrosion. Schedule pre-winter and post-winter check-ups at a local shop familiar with Adirondack driving conditions to ensure your Kia is prepared for steep grades and icy roads.
